RIP Leslie West

Well…damn, another one of my musical family died last night…Leslie West, founder of Mountain and other groups is gone after a heart attack that he couldn’t recover from. From the first time I heard “Mississippi Queen” and it’s cowbell intro, I knew he was something special…and I still get chills when Leslie comes in with the power and slashing guitar…I’ve always thought that the song was one of the most perfect 3:39 in rock history and Leslie’s growling vocals still takes my breath away…I could always tell when a guitar riff of his was playing…he has this choppy, power style that was raw and yet he could be subtle, too…I was fortunate enough to get to see him live three times…once with Felix Pappalardi as Mountain, and two other times with Leslie as a solo act…the last time at the intersection downtown where I could walk right up to the stage and watch him play from about 10 feet away…just frickin amazing….while they were great on studio albums, to get to the core of Leslie and Mountain, you have to hear their live recordings…I would recommend that you find a copy of their double live album “Twin Peaks” that was recorded in Japan….and listen to “Nantucket Sleighride”….thirty minutes of power where they put together bits and pieces of other songs to make an epic live jam….but it’s not the noodling kind of stuff that jam bands get into…it’s full power blast that ebbs and flows and shows you just how good Leslie was….I’m going to miss him…RIP Leslie….
